  • CVE-2019-18938CriNov 14, 2019
    risk 0.66cvss 9.8epss 0.34

    eQ-3 Homematic CCU2 2.47.20 and CCU3 3.47.18 with the E-Mail AddOn through 1.6.8.c installed allow Remote Code Execution by unauthenticated attackers with access to the web interface via the save.cgi script for payload upload and the testtcl.cgi script for its execution.

  • CVE-2019-18937CriNov 14, 2019
    risk 0.66cvss 9.8epss 0.34

    eQ-3 Homematic CCU2 2.47.20 and CCU3 3.47.18 with the Script Parser AddOn through 1.8 installed allow Remote Code Execution by unauthenticated attackers with access to the web interface via the exec.cgi script, which executes TCL script content from an HTTP POST request.

  • CVE-2019-16199CriSep 17, 2019
    risk 0.65cvss 9.8epss 0.13

    eQ-3 Homematic CCU2 before 2.47.18 and CCU3 before 3.47.18 allow Remote Code Execution by unauthenticated attackers with access to the web interface via an HTTP POST request to certain URLs related to the ReGa core process.

  • CVE-2019-14985CriAug 13, 2019
    risk 0.65cvss 9.8epss 0.11

    eQ-3 Homematic CCU2 and CCU3 with the CUxD AddOn installed allow Remote Code Execution by unauthenticated attackers with access to the web interface, because this interface can access the CMD_EXEC virtual device type 28.

  • CVE-2018-7301CriFeb 22, 2018
    risk 0.64cvss 9.8epss 0.01

    eQ-3 AG HomeMatic CCU2 2.29.22 devices have an open XML-RPC port without authentication. This can be exploited by sending arbitrary XML-RPC requests to control the attached BidCos devices.
